How Much Does Tree Removal Cost in Cedar Hill?

Aspects such as tree size, access, safety, and the number of trees requiring removal all impact the cost of tree removal. On average, Cedar Hill homeowners pay about $626 for tree removal, though costs can range from $238 to $999. Trees in Cedar Hill tend to be on the small side, which can decrease the price of services.

Some situations call for emergency tree removal, such as if an intense storm partially dislodges a tree near your home. Emergency tree removal in Cedar Hill costs an average of $936.

Signs That a Tree Needs to Be Removed

Older trees, which are common in Cedar Hill, are more susceptible to disease, general wear and tear, and damage. You may need these trees removed if you discover:

  • The trunk branches off in different directions into multiple large , heavy branches
  • Cracks in the trunk , especially deep cracks
  • Fungus or mold
  • Cracking between branches , especially large heavy ones
  • Rot , dead branches , missing bark or leaves , and other signs of decay

Trees that lean or have raised dirt around the base are at an increased risk of falling. If you notice any of these signs, have the tree evaluated immediately. You may also need to have a tree assessed if it’s growing too close to your home or to utility lines — many communities and utility companies have their own policies for how close a tree can get.

Do Tree Removal Companies Need to be Licensed in Texas?

Texas does not have specific licensing requirements for tree removal companies, but it’s important to check with your local municipal government to ensure your provider meets the requirements in your area. Choose a trustworthy company that has workers compensation and liability insurance. You may feel more at ease entrusting your tree removal needs to a licensed general contractor. An individual can also become a licensed arborist through the International Society of Arboriculture (ISA). While not required, this certification indicates that an individual is trained in all aspects of arboriculture and follows the ISA’s code of ethics. You can search for a licensed arborist or verify credentials on the ISA’s search tool.

The green ash, honey mesquite, and sugarberry trees are commonly found in Cedar Hill. The average height of a tree in the area is 38 feet, and the average tree is 60 years old.

Ways you can keep your trees healthy include periodically pruning dead or excessive branches, keeping heavy lawn equipment or vehicles off the roots, and replenishing soil around the base if it starts to erode. Consider pest control services if insects are harming your trees.

More often than not, you can keep the wood from trees that are cut down on your property, but consult with your tree removal expert first. If you'd rather remove the wood, talk to your removal company to see if they provide those services, or contact your local waste management agency for help. Avoid leaving downed trees sitting in your yard and don't store cut wood against your home — both can result in pest problems.
